Mastering Database Migration

A corporate guide to minimizing downtime, ensuring data integrity, and leveraging modern tools for a seamless transition.

The Migration Landscape by the Numbers

3

Dominant Strategies

Big Bang, Trickle, and Zero-Downtime approaches form the core of modern migration planning.

90%+

Target Near-Zero Downtime

Continuous availability is now the default goal for critical production workloads in the cloud era.

100%

Focus on Validation

Experts agree: automated data reconciliation and integrity checks are non-negotiable for success.

The Three-Stage Migration Lifecycle

1

Plan

Define scope, identify stakeholders, map dependencies, establish validation criteria, and create a comprehensive rollback strategy.

2

Execute

Utilize replication for data sync, automate schema changes, perform phased cutovers, and monitor performance throughout the process.

3

Verify

Conduct data reconciliation, run application-level tests, benchmark performance against baselines, and obtain stakeholder sign-off.

Choosing Your Strategy: Risk vs. Complexity

StrategyDowntime RiskComplexityBest For
Big BangHigh (Scheduled Outage)LowNon-critical systems, dev/test environments, small datasets.
Trickle (Phased)Medium (Brief cutovers)MediumLarge complex systems, migrating by service or business unit.
Zero DowntimeNear-ZeroHighMission-critical, 24/7 applications, customer-facing services.

Challenges & Opportunities

Key Migration Challenges
+
  • Downtime Risk: Balancing outage windows with business continuity.
  • Data Integrity: Preventing data loss or corruption during transfer and transformation.
  • Complex Dependencies: Managing interconnected applications, jobs, and reporting pipelines.
  • Scale & Transfer Time: Handling large datasets efficiently across networks.
  • Governance & Compliance: Ensuring security and data residency requirements are met.

Strategic Opportunities
+
  • Modernization: Move to scalable, managed cloud services and reduce operational burden.
  • Performance Gains: Optimize schemas, indexing, and queries on a superior platform.
  • Improved Resilience: Enhance availability and disaster recovery with cloud-native features.
  • Cost Reduction: Decommission expensive legacy hardware and licenses.
  • Better Data Quality: Use the migration as a catalyst for data cleanup and standardization.

The Modern Migration Toolkit

Cloud-Native Migration Services
High Impact

Replication & CDC Tools
High Impact